Constants ¶
const ( // PayloadTypePCMU is a payload type for ITU-T G.711 PCM μ-Law audio 64 kbit/s (RFC 3551). PayloadTypePCMU = 0 // PayloadTypeGSM is a payload type for European GSM Full Rate audio 13 kbit/s (GSM 06.10). PayloadTypeGSM = 3 // PayloadTypeG723 is a payload type for ITU-T G.723.1 audio (RFC 3551). PayloadTypeG723 = 4 // PayloadTypeDVI4_8000 is a payload type for IMA ADPCM audio 32 kbit/s (RFC 3551). PayloadTypeDVI4_8000 = 5 // PayloadTypeDVI4_16000 is a payload type for IMA ADPCM audio 64 kbit/s (RFC 3551). PayloadTypeDVI4_16000 = 6 // PayloadTypeLPC is a payload type for Experimental Linear Predictive Coding audio 5.6 kbit/s (RFC 3551). PayloadTypeLPC = 7 // PayloadTypePCMA is a payload type for ITU-T G.711 PCM A-Law audio 64 kbit/s (RFC 3551). PayloadTypePCMA = 8 // PayloadTypeG722 is a payload type for ITU-T G.722 audio 64 kbit/s (RFC 3551). PayloadTypeG722 = 9 // PayloadTypeL16Stereo is a payload type for Linear PCM 16-bit Stereo audio 1411.2 kbit/s, uncompressed (RFC 3551). PayloadTypeL16Stereo = 10 // PayloadTypeL16Mono is a payload type for Linear PCM 16-bit audio 705.6 kbit/s, uncompressed (RFC 3551). PayloadTypeL16Mono = 11 // PayloadTypeQCELP is a payload type for Qualcomm Code Excited Linear Prediction (RFC 2658, RFC 3551). PayloadTypeQCELP = 12 // PayloadTypeCN is a payload type for Comfort noise (RFC 3389). PayloadTypeCN = 13 // PayloadTypeMPA is a payload type for MPEG-1 or MPEG-2 audio only (RFC 3551, RFC 2250). PayloadTypeMPA = 14 // PayloadTypeG728 is a payload type for ITU-T G.728 audio 16 kbit/s (RFC 3551). PayloadTypeG728 = 15 // PayloadTypeDVI4_11025 is a payload type for IMA ADPCM audio 44.1 kbit/s (RFC 3551). PayloadTypeDVI4_11025 = 16 // PayloadTypeDVI4_22050 is a payload type for IMA ADPCM audio 88.2 kbit/s (RFC 3551). PayloadTypeDVI4_22050 = 17 // PayloadTypeG729 is a payload type for ITU-T G.729 and G.729a audio 8 kbit/s (RFC 3551, RFC 3555). PayloadTypeG729 = 18 )
Audio Payload Types as defined in https://www.iana.org/assignments/rtp-parameters/rtp-parameters.xhtml
const ( // PayloadTypeCELLB is a payload type for Sun CellB video (RFC 2029). PayloadTypeCELLB = 25 // PayloadTypeJPEG is a payload type for JPEG video (RFC 2435). PayloadTypeJPEG = 26 // PayloadTypeNV is a payload type for Xerox PARC's Network Video (nv, RFC 3551). PayloadTypeNV = 28 // PayloadTypeH261 is a payload type for ITU-T H.261 video (RFC 4587). PayloadTypeH261 = 31 // PayloadTypeMPV is a payload type for MPEG-1 and MPEG-2 video (RFC 2250). PayloadTypeMPV = 32 // PayloadTypeMP2T is a payload type for MPEG-2 transport stream (RFC 2250). PayloadTypeMP2T = 33 // PayloadTypeH263 is a payload type for H.263 video, first version (1996, RFC 3551, RFC 2190). PayloadTypeH263 = 34 )
Video Payload Types as defined in https://www.iana.org/assignments/rtp-parameters/rtp-parameters.xhtml
const (
// PayloadTypeFirstDynamic is a first non-static payload type.
PayloadTypeFirstDynamic = 35
)

type AudioLevelExtension ¶
AudioLevelExtension is a extension payload format described in https://tools.ietf.org/html/rfc6464
Implementation based on: https://chromium.googlesource.com/external/webrtc/+/e2a017725570ead5946a4ca8235af27470ca0df9/webrtc/modules/rtp_rtcp/source/rtp_header_extensions.cc#49
One byte format: 0 1 0 1 2 3 4 5 6 7 8 9 0 1 2 3 4 5 +-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+ | ID | len=0 |V| level | +-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+
Two byte format: 0 1 2 3 0 1 2 3 4 5 6 7 8 9 0 1 2 3 4 5 6 7 8 9 0 1 2 3 4 5 6 7 8 9 0 1 +-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+ | ID | len=1 |V| level | 0 (pad) | +-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+

type Depacketizer ¶
type Depacketizer interface {
// Unmarshal parses the RTP payload and returns media.
// Metadata may be stored on the Depacketizer itself
Unmarshal(packet []byte) ([]byte, error)
// Checks if the packet is at the beginning of a partition. This
// should return false if the result could not be determined, in
// which case the caller will detect timestamp discontinuities.
IsPartitionHead(payload []byte) bool
// Checks if the packet is at the end of a partition. This should
// return false if the result could not be determined.
IsPartitionTail(marker bool, payload []byte) bool
}
Depacketizer depacketizes a RTP payload, removing any RTP specific data from the payload.

type Header ¶
type Header struct {
Version uint8
Padding bool
Extension bool
Marker bool
PayloadType uint8
SequenceNumber uint16
Timestamp uint32
SSRC uint32
CSRC []uint32
ExtensionProfile uint16
Extensions []Extension
// Deprecated: will be removed in a future version.
PayloadOffset int
}
Header represents an RTP packet header.
